Shot Accessories

These are the accessory tools that have made a big difference in my shot consistency. I have these listed in the order that I use them when making a shot. 

 
Ryan Fontaine profile picture
A funnel is nice to have to keep your grounds contained before tamping. I like this one because of the magnets to keep it in place.
54mm Espresso Dosing Funnel with Magnetic
 
Ryan Fontaine profile picture
A scale is an essential tool, both to weigh your beans and to weigh your shot. This one is small and compact and will fit under your grinder and your portafilter. It has a timer as well for dialing in your shot consistency.
Maestri House Mini Coffee Scale w/ Timer USB-C
 
Ryan Fontaine profile picture
A WDT is essential to ensure you don't get clumps that can cause channeling in your shot. This one is low cost, compact, and easy to use.
WDT Espresso Distribution Tools
 
Ryan Fontaine profile picture
I use this after using my WDT to get a good distribution prior to tamping. This thing is HEAVY for it's size and feel really well made.
MHW-3BOMBER Espresso Distributor 53.35mm
 
Ryan Fontaine profile picture
This spring tamper helps you get a more consistent and even pressure on your grounds. I like that it has the spring and audible feedback when you've hit the right pressure so there's no guessing involved. The black and wood finish is a nice touch as ...
MHW-3BOMBER 53.35mm Espresso Coffee Tamper
 
Ryan Fontaine profile picture
This puck screen helps reduce channeling and gives a more even water flow into your portafilter. It also keeps the grounds from directly contacting your brewing head to keep it cleaner. The screen is easy to clean and this one is 54mm to match with t...
